The Impact of Regulation on Online Gambling Behavior
Study Overview
A recent study conducted by Aarhus University aimed to explore how regulatory changes within Denmark have influenced online gambling behaviors. The goal was to determine whether increased regulation leads to safer gambling environments and reduced instances of problem gambling.
Methodology
Researchers utilized a mixed-methods approach, combining quantitative surveys with qualitative interviews. Approximately 1,500 online gamblers participated in the survey, while in-depth interviews involved 30 individuals identified as at-risk gamblers.
Key Findings
The results indicated that the introduction of stricter regulations significantly decreased the number of individuals engaging in high-risk gambling activities. Specifically, the study reported a 25% reduction in self-reported problem gambling among participants exposed to regulated environments.
Interpretation
These findings suggest that regulatory measures, such as mandatory self-exclusion options and limits on betting amounts, play a crucial role in promoting responsible gambling practices. This highlights the need for continued vigilance in policy-making to ensure the protection of vulnerable players.
Technological Advancements in Online Casinos
Study Overview
As part of their examination into casino online Danmark, the University of Copenhagen investigated how technological advancements, particularly artificial intelligence (AI) and machine learning, are reshaping the landscape of online gambling.
Methodology
The researchers employed a comprehensive literature review complemented by case studies from leading online casinos in Denmark that integrate AI into their platforms.
Key Findings
The study revealed that AI algorithms enhance user experience by providing personalized recommendations and tailoring gaming experiences. Additionally, it was found that AI systems reduced fraud by effectively identifying suspicious behavior patterns. This led to a reported 40% decrease in fraudulent activities.
Interpretation
The use of advanced technologies not only enhances the gambling experience but also significantly increases security measures. Consequently, the integration of AI in online casinos could set a new standard for operational efficiency and user trust.
Player Demographics and Their Gambling Preferences
Study Overview
A demographic study conducted by the Danish Gambling Authority focused on understanding the demographics of online casino players and their specific preferences. The aim was to identify trends that could inform marketing strategies for online casino operators.
Methodology
The study surveyed 2000 Danish online gamblers, collecting data on age, gender, and preferred gambling activities. The additional analytical tool used was factor analysis to determine patterns in gambling preferences.
Key Findings
The results demonstrated that younger players (ages 18-30) predominantly favored fast-paced games such as online slots and live dealer games, while older players showed a preference for traditional table games like poker and blackjack. Interestingly, 30% of players reported using mobile devices for gambling, indicating a shift towards mobile gaming.
Interpretation
This shift in preferences has significant implications for marketing strategies within the industry. Online casinos will need to adapt their offerings and promotional tactics to cater to the growing demand for mobile-friendly gaming options among younger players.
Responsible Gambling Initiatives and Their Effectiveness
Study Overview
The final study discussed was conducted by the Danish Institute of Public Health, which evaluated the effectiveness of various responsible gambling initiatives implemented by online platforms.
Methodology
The researchers reviewed data from multiple online casinos that had integrated responsible gaming tools, such as deposit limits and cooling-off periods. Feedback from players was collected through surveys and analyzed for trends and satisfaction levels.
Key Findings
The results highlighted that players who utilized responsible gambling tools reported a 35% increase in overall satisfaction with their gaming experiences. Furthermore, players who set self-imposed limits exhibited significantly lower rates of problematic gambling behavior.
Interpretation
This study underscores the importance of promoting responsible gambling tools as a means of enhancing player welfare. It also suggests that online casinos should invest in better marketing of these resources to ensure players are aware of their options.
